Hi,there
i have  a problem with nessus.when i try to launch a scan in my linux
command line.I always got the error as follows :

[root@localhost ~]# /opt/NetScan/bin/nessus -qVx localhost 16371 mao 123
/opt/NetScan/target /opt/NetScan/result.xml

[3829] SSL_connect: error:00000000:lib(0):func(0):reason(0)

nessus : SSL error



and i have checked my log information:

vi var/nessus/logs/nessusd.messages

it tells:

[Mon Aug  4 10:04:54 2008][3827] nessusd 2.2.10. started

[Mon Aug  4 10:05:03 2008][3827] connection from 127.0.0.1

[Mon Aug  4 10:05:03 2008][3830] SIGSEGV occured !



i have installed nessus in /opt/NetScan and i am sure i have my nessusd
working correctly:

[root@localhost ~]# /opt/NetScan/sbin/nessusd -D

All plugins loaded



[root@localhost NetScan]# /opt/NetScan/sbin/nessusd -d

This is Nessus 2.2.10 for Linux 2.6.18-53.el5xen

compiled with gcc version 4.1.2 20070626 (Red Hat 4.1.2-14)

Current setup :

        nasl                           : 2.2.10

        libnessus                      : 2.2.10

        SSL support                    : enabled

        SSL is used for client / server communication

        Running as euid                : 0



and i am sure that my nessusd is listenning on the 16371 port,for :

[root@localhost ~]# lsof -i

nessusd   3827   root    4u  IPv4  11423       TCP *:16371 (LISTEN)



now i am not sure where is the problem and how to solve it!

can anyone help?
